This New Device By Sony Will Allow You To Play PS5 Games Anywhere

Sony’s newest brainchild, the PlayStation Portal, is poised to give gaming aficionados on their favourite PlayStation games a new lease of life. After the big reveal teased in ‘Project Q’ earlier this annum, Sony has now let slip not just the official moniker but also tidbits about this compact gaming gadget crafted poorly or explicitly rather for terrific gameplay and mobility.

The PlayStation Portal, a nifty little handheld gaming tool comes in at $199.99 for purchasing. Its capacity means players can stream games directly from their PS5 console through remote play – and it’s all done via Wi-Fi, no strings attached! Armed with an 8-inch LCD screen capable of showcasing graphics of up to 1080p resolution, all moving smoothly at a rate of 60 frames per second, carrying this gem around allows gamers to have mind-blowing visuals and fluid gameplay on the tip of their fingers – regardless where they are.

However, it’s important to note that the PlayStation Portal is exclusively designed for Remote Play. As such, it won’t support PSVR2 games or cloud-enabled games available through PlayStation Plus Premium. To ensure a smooth gaming experience, Sony recommends a broadband Wi-Fi connection of at least 5Mbps, with 15Mbps or higher preferred.

In addition to the PlayStation Portal, Sony unveiled two new wireless audio devices that can connect to both PS5 consoles and the PlayStation Portal using the proprietary PlayStation Link technology. The Pulse Elite wireless headset offers lossless audio with AI-enhanced noise rejection and a retractable boom mic, priced at $149.99. The Pulse Explore, Sony’s first wireless earbuds, provide premium portable audio with dual microphones and AI-enhanced noise rejection, priced at $199.99.
